BBQ Ready | Kayaks & Paddleboards | 10 Mi to Town Experience lake life at its finest with a stay at this 3-bed, 2-bath Eatonton vacation rental! The cabin has a rustic interior with cozy wood accents, a full kitchen, and multiple outdoor spaces fit for the whole crew. Sip morning coffee in the screened deck and relish the peaceful views, then cast a line or make a splash off the dock! Ready to explore? Visit town and tour the Historic Uncle Remus Museum or hike through Oconee National Forest. The space SLEEPING ARRANGEMENTS - Bedroom 1: 1 king bed - Bedroom 2: 1 queen bed - Bedroom 3: 2 twin beds - Lower Living Room: 1 queen sleeper sofa OUTDOOR LIVING - Screened deck w/ seating - Furnished patio, 2 dining areas - Wood-burning fire pit, private backyard - Furnished porch, gas grill (propane provided) - Kayaks, paddleboards, life vests - Private dock, beach towels - Lake views & access INDOOR LIVING - 2 living areas, Smart TV - Dining table, breakfast bar - Board games, piano KITCHEN - Refrigerator, stove/oven, dishwasher - Dishware/flatware, cooking basics - Keurig/drip coffee maker (bring your own coffee) - Microwave, ice maker GENERAL - Free WiFi - Central A/C & heating, ceiling fans - Linens/towels, washer/dryer - Trash bags, paper towels - Hair dryer, bar of soap ACCESSIBILITY - 2-story cabin w/ lower level, 8 steps to enter - 2nd-floor bedrooms only FAQ - Dock not accessible for boats (October-December 2025) PARKING - Driveway (4 vehicles) Guest access Guests will have access to the entire property via keyless entry Other things to note - No smoking - No pets allowed - No events, parties, or large gatherings - Must be at least 18 years old to book - Additional fees and taxes may apply - Photo ID may be required upon check-in ADDITIONAL INFORMATION - This 2-story cabin with a lower level requires 8 steps to enter; all bedrooms are on the 2nd floor - Please be aware that the Lake Sinclair drawdown begins on October 25, 2025. The lake level will drop 5 feet, and the dock will not be accessible for boats during this time. Canoeing, paddleboarding, and kayaking from the lakeshore will still be available. The lake will fill again beginning on December 1, 2025
